THE FIRST PRIZE

The Japanese had also turned  Corregidor into a storehouse of  loot from Manila. The island almost floated on a sea of booze. If they'd intended to ship it home, it was far too late for that.  Maybe they didn't even know what they could do with it, they just took it because they could. It was too late for them to drink it - but not for us.  Included were Four Roses Whiskey and Bacardi Rum, both well appreciated - until the Officers took control.
